JavaScript Developer Bootcamp - Beginner to Expert

Master Modern JavaScript by Building 50 Projects: Web Dev, Object Oriented & Asynchronous Programming, Game & AI Dev

4.65 (333 reviews)
Udemy
platform
English
language
Web Development
category
instructor
JavaScript Developer Bootcamp - Beginner to Expert
2,869
students
63.5 hours
content
Jun 2022
last update
$79.99
regular price

What you will learn

You will learn JavaScript from scratch

You will master all the new features of JavaScript

You will master JavaScript Array Literal Data Structure

You will master JavaScript Object Literal Data Structure

You will master JavaScript Loops

You will master JavaScript Functions

You will master JavaScript DOM

You will master JavaScript Regular Expressions

You will master advanced JavaScript Data Structures

You will master JavaScript Object Oriented Programming

You will master JavaScript Asynchronous Programming

You will master Game Development with JavaScript

You will learn AI Algorithm Development with JavaScript

Why take this course?

Welcome to the most comprehensive JavaScript course EVER. This course offers a fresh perspective on one of the most popular programming languages of all time, JavaScript. In this course, I will walk you through the basics first. We will cover all the Data Structures of JavaScript in depth. Then, we will cover JavaScript Loops, Functions and the DOM. There are 100+ examples in this course and all of these examples have been strategically created to make sure you get the most out of this course.

There are 50 real world projects in this course. The projects will start from a beginner level and will go to an expert level. The first 27 projects cover beginner to intermediate skill levels and we will create amazing applications.

The Second Part of this course focuses more on the advanced part of JavaScript. Firstly, we will cover Regular Expressions and Advanced JavaScript Data Structures. Then, we will cover how JavaScript works extensively and exhaustively. I will teach you Scope, Hoisting and Closure. I will also teach you Object Oriented Programming (OOP) and Asynchronous Programming.

At this point in course, we will have 2 projects for Regular Expressions. Afterwards, we are going to create 1 large application using the OOP paradigm.

Then, we will have 8 projects for Asynchronous Programming for the Fetch API and the Async Await plus 1 project for the Web Speech API.

The Third Part of this course focuses on Game & AI development with JavaScript. I will introduce you to the HTML5 Canvas Element. I will also use OOP paradigm.

Firstly, we will create 4 projects, beginner to intermediate level, to master collision detection + OOP in game development.

Finally, we will create 7 games and we will code 3 complete AI Algorithms throughout these 7 projects.

So, without further ado, let's dive into this course and master JavaScript once and for all.

Screenshots

JavaScript Developer Bootcamp - Beginner to Expert - Screenshot_01JavaScript Developer Bootcamp - Beginner to Expert - Screenshot_02JavaScript Developer Bootcamp - Beginner to Expert - Screenshot_03JavaScript Developer Bootcamp - Beginner to Expert - Screenshot_04

Reviews

Mwadi
October 28, 2023
The course I took was fantastic ? ? ? I loved the projects Most of them were challenging but I got them right
Asif
October 11, 2023
just after completing css layout course I directly jumped to this javascript course. course is so great and the instructor too. learned many things thank you. I have one request can you create a course on logic building and also full-stack courses using nextJs and redux, Firebase or Mongodb? waiting for the next course.
Programmer
July 15, 2023
Awesome course! Lessons are logically arranged and the tutor is explaining in great depth. Many tips and shortcuts are taught here which I could not find in other similar courses.
Mwadi
December 1, 2022
The course I took was fantastic ? ? ? I loved the projects Most of them were challenging but I got them right
Erica
November 18, 2022
This course has been the most in depth JavaScript course that I have taken. The instructor does such an amazing job of explaining everything. By far he is one of my favorite instructors and I own a lot of Udemy courses.
Christopher
November 15, 2022
The walk through videos. This bootcamp is the best I've found yet! its exactly what I was looking for! Thank you
Jennifer
September 30, 2022
I think this is going to be a great course!! I've purchased three JavaScript courses and I'm taking all three. Each one is unique and each instructor is unique as well. I was very careful in choosing the courses. I believe they will compliment each other. I like the way each instructor teaches. I even bought a couple and returned them before I found the three I wanted. I hope to have a well rounded JavaScript knowledge base after I finish them.. Muslim is very smart and enthusiastic. This JavaScript class is over 60 hrs and he is very happy while he teaches. He put a lot of time and effort in this class and I like that a lot.. He is very knowledgeable. And speaks perfect English. Perfect.. It's going to be a great class! JennC
Paydar
September 17, 2022
Course is 5/5 for sure but my suggestion is the instructor needs to add a couple of full-webdev projects to the course since that's what 99.9% of people taking this course are looking for. maybe build one full personal blog with one ecom website OR an agency website or a portfolio website. since the instructor is also a fantastic css teacher, my guess is adding these website projects will make this course the best javascript course on whole udemy. i highly recommend U adding website projects to this course. thanks for all the value you provide brother muslim.
abumariyam
September 11, 2022
this course is more than I expected, especially your detailed explanation. I explain with pleasure, Thank you very much, please do not just stop at this, keep going, if there was 10 stars I would evaluate this course with 10 stars!!!!!
Yash
August 23, 2022
I have done a Javascript course which I left halfway due to the lack of projects and the verbose structure and left my JS journey midway. Then after searching for a month , bought this course. I can say that this course is the best, especially for people like me who want to see the real world applications more along with the theoretical part. Will be completing this course from start to finish. Thanks Muslim, you are a genius.
Frond
August 9, 2022
This is best course about javascript in the whole udemy , muslim as always has a profound , simple and in deth explanation. Every time he uploads a course i will be extremely happy because i know that muslim's course will save me time and money .In addition Muslim knows what students are struggling to understand that is why his explanation for complex concepts are very understandable and clear .
Jamal
June 23, 2022
This course has 68 sections, I will come back to this review after every 10 sections and give my 2 cents. June 21nd: Completed upto section 10, and I'm loving it. He explained different Javascript basics and promises that the projects will clear things up even better. I'm a bit nervous that, now I have to get into projects but we will see. Why am I nervous when I know he will be guiding me through the projects? I don't know
A
February 8, 2022
I still haven't finished all of the contents in this course ( watched about 23%(?) of the contents so far), and this course is a great course to learn tricks to implement in future personal projects. What I would like to comment on is that this course can be better with some guideline to go along with. To a complete noob like me, some concepts and projects are difficult to comprehend and sometimes I just had to decide- "Ok, I'm gonna come back to this project later." Of-course, I understand that in a real world context-as Halelee has mentioned in the lectures-, there won't be an apt & knowledgeable instrustor like Helalee to hold our - the newbies - hands to guide us every signle step of the way, therefore the need to go ahead and do researches on our own to improve & polish our skillset. I think that for some projects it might help the beginners if there is an easy-way-of-solving-this-project & advanced-way-of-soliving-this-project paths. I think adding more contents could become a tedious process, so I'm not forcing and telling the instructor to do so. So no pressure & no offence. Really :) For now, this is how I feel, but I'm going to march on and finish all of the lectures and see if I can understand where I couldn't before :) Lastly, Thank you so much for the great contents & opportunity which you have given, Helalee. All the best to you.
Chae
February 2, 2022
so far I've learned until project 2. Learning basic syntax and doing real project is really nice. For better learning, I wish instructor gives tips and tools to use at the beginning of each project, so I could try it myself better.
Kazuhiro
January 26, 2022
JavaScriptの基礎から応用までを網羅しており、講座内で50個のアプリを作っていくため、実際どのようにJavaScriptを書くのかがわかるのでかなりオススメです! I understood how powerful JavaScript is and how cool the Instructor is from this course! I'm looking forward to your next course(React?)!! Thank you from Japan.

Charts

Price

JavaScript Developer Bootcamp - Beginner to Expert - Price chart

Rating

JavaScript Developer Bootcamp - Beginner to Expert - Ratings chart

Enrollment distribution

JavaScript Developer Bootcamp - Beginner to Expert - Distribution chart
3429704
udemy ID
8/18/2020
course created date
11/27/2020
course indexed date
Bot
course submited by